Safety And Security Tips for Participants
Participants ought to prioritize security throughout the Halloween scavenger hunt to make sure a fun and satisfying experience for every person included. It is critical to establish boundaries for the scavenger hunt location. Plainly specify the restrictions to stay clear of individuals roaming into unknown or risky places.
Motivate participants to clothe properly for the weather and environment, deciding for comfortable shoes to avoid drops and slips. Costumes should be well-fitted and not hamper motion; stay clear of masks that block vision or accessories that might be hazardous.
In addition, participants should continue to be in groups, as this enhances safety and security and makes sure that everyone keeps an eye out for one another. Develop a check-in system to represent all participants, specifically children, that should be come with by an adult in all times.
Finally, be conscious of the time, ensuring the scavenger search concludes prior to dark. If activities prolong into the evening, give adequate lights and reflectors to increase exposure. By sticking to these safety ideas, individuals can fully immerse themselves in the Halloween spirit while appreciating a exciting and safe scavenger quest experience.
Prize Ideas for Victors
As the excitement of the Halloween scavenger search recommended you read develops, identifying the efforts of participants with enticing rewards can boost inspiration and enjoyment. Selecting the best rewards can raise the experience and encourage friendly competition among participants of all ages.
Think about supplying Halloween-themed rewards, such as decorative pumpkins, spooky candles, or themed gift baskets filled up with treats like sweet corn and delicious chocolate bars. Furthermore, little playthings or ornaments, like glow-in-the-dark devices or Halloween sticker labels, can interest more youthful individuals. For adults, think about gift certifications to neighborhood restaurants or shops, or a container of seasonal wine to celebrate their victory.
Another involving alternative is to give experience-based rewards, such as tickets to a neighborhood haunted residence or a family members pass to a pumpkin spot. These prizes not only reward victors yet additionally motivate continued participation in community occasions.
For an extra individualized touch, produce customized certificates or prizes that identify accomplishments in various categories, such as "Ideal Team" or "Many Innovative Costume." These thoughtful motions can make the event memorable and cultivate a feeling of sociability amongst individuals. Ultimately, appropriate prizes can transform an enjoyable scavenger search into an unforgettable Halloween experience.
